Off the NY State Thruway I-90, the quaint city of Auburn is located just 35 miles west of Syracuse, right in the heart of the Finger Lakes Region of Upstate New York. A city rich in history, culture and arts, Auburn features several national treasures and historic sites like the William Seward House where William Seward, President Abraham Lincoln's Secretary of State, spearheaded the purchase of the Alaskan Territory from Russia in 1867, the Harriet Tubman Home  that preserves the legacy of Harriet Tubman, one of the most famous abolitionists in American History, and the Williard Chapel  which contains the only known complete and unatlered display of extremely beautiful Louis C. Tiffany and Tiffany Glass & Decoration Co. chapel windows.



 

Auburn’s downtown is a hub for business, entertainment, festivals and special events highlighted with the eye-catching Owasco River running through the center of it. With award-winning dining and craft breweries like Moro’s Table and the Prison City Pub & Brewery, Auburn is the perfect destination for a delicious mix of culture and cuisine.


Just a few miles to the north, the town of Weedsport was incorporated around the time of the Erie Canal and provides a good example of Erie Canal stone work, and additional attractions around Auburn include the Weedsport Speedway  and the DIRT Hall of Fame and Classic Car Museum.
